Sheep Trail Gulch
Sheep Trail Gulch is a valley in Tehama County, Shasta Cascades, California and has an elevation of 2,438 feet. Sheep Trail Gulch is situated nearby to the hamlet Shackleford Place, as well as near Hammer Place.| Tap on a place to explore it |
